Speedway, drivers cross finish line with banquetBy LOGAN NEILL© St. Petersburg Times, published December 11, 2001 For Herb Neumann Jr., it was the easiest money he has earned all year. The newly crowned Citrus County Speedway Late Model champion, who drove 25 races, had to stroll only a few feet to collect a $2,500 check Saturday night during the annual Women's Racing Club Awards Banquet. "If only every week was like that," said Neumann, who was among 60 drivers in seven divisions honored with a portion of this year's $20,000 in points fund prize money. Neumann, who has competed 16 seasons at the track, snared his first Late Model championship with five wins and 12 top-five finishes. Other first-time champions included Frank Coleman (Mini Stock), Travis Nichols (Street Stock), Richie Smith (Hobby Stock) and Stuart Madison (Thunder Stock).
